SUMMARY:

The Quality Assurance Engineer is responsible for supporting and maintaining quality systems within a regulated manufacturing environment, ensuring compliance with current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P), FDA regulations, and other applicable standards. This role involves analyzing production and laboratory data, investigating deviations, and driving corrective and preventive actions (CAPA) to resolve quality issues and prevent recurrence. The QA Engineer collaborates cross functionally with production, laboratory, and other departments to identify trends, improve processes, and ensure product quality and regulatory compliance.

PO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Receiving, filling, archiving and update data base for controlled documents, (BR's logbooks, Reports, Protocols etc.).
  • Prepare/update and maintain other documents needed for the QA Department.
  • Issue to different department Controlled documents, (Form, logbooks, etc.)
  • Managing and tracking performance of Quality Systems (i.e., Change Control, CAPAs, Deviations/Investigation, Laboratory Investigations and Complaints) in Agile Enterprise Business system.
  • Run Oracle reports for completed training and approve all CRNs requested by system notification.
  • Updating document format prior to close the CRN.
  • Review and update assigned quality/operational procedures to assure compliance with Company Policies and Regulatory requirements.
  • Review and approves quality documents to assure correctness, completeness and compliance to company procedure and Regulatory requirements.
  • Prepare and maintain the Master Production Records
  • Create and send Issuance of notification for BR, WI, SOP and Validation Protocol.
  • Draft departmental NOE, minor deviations and investigations as required.
